Marvel Studios and Sony Pictures’ Spider-Man: Brand New Day has become one of the fastest films in history to surpass $1 billion at the global box office, reaching the milestone just six days after its release.
Starring Tom Holland as Peter Parker, the latest Spider-Man installment has drawn massive audiences worldwide, delivering one of the strongest theatrical openings in recent years and cementing its place among Hollywood’s biggest box office successes.
Second-fastest film to reach $1 billion
According to industry box office figures, only Marvel’s Avengers: Endgame (2019) reached the $1 billion mark faster. That film generated approximately $1.2 billion globally during its opening weekend.
The rapid success of Spider-Man: Brand New Day highlights the continued global popularity of the Marvel franchise and the enduring appeal of the Spider-Man character.
Record-breaking performance in North America
The film also posted exceptional numbers in North America, earning $407 million during its first four days, setting a new benchmark and surpassing the previous record held by Black Panther (2018) for the same release period.
The strong domestic and international performance has positioned the film among the highest-grossing Hollywood releases of recent years.
